Baseball Preview: Mountain View Bears vs. Mill Creek Hawks
Mountain View is 2-8 against Mill Creek since March of 2021 but they'll have a chance to close the gap a little bit on Wednesday. The Mountain View Bears will head out on the road to take on the Mill Creek Hawks at 6:00 p.m.
Mountain View was not able to break out of their rough patch on Monday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They fell 7-2 to Mill Creek.
Mountain View got a good showing from Trevor Waite, who tossed two innings while giving up no earned run or hits (he also only allowed one walk). Waite has been consistent recently: he hasn't given up more than two walks in three consecutive pitching appearances.
On the hitting side, Mountain View saw six different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Julian Hayes, who scored a run while getting on base in three of his four plate appearances. Another player making a difference was Nick Clayborn, who went 2-for-3 with a double and an RBI.
Mountain View's loss dropped their record down to 9-13. As for Mill Creek, the win (which was their eighth in a row) raised their record to 16-7.
